| GRE | Session 87 | 25-28 Oct 2022 | 16. The experts from Germany and TF AVSR tabled a proposal for vehicles that may be operated by driver support features, automated driving features or by an Automated Driving System (ADS) (ECE/TRANS/WP.29/GRE/2022/14 and GRE-87-11). Having delivered remarks on the proposal and in view of ongoing activities in other Working Parties (GRs), in particular the Working Party on Automated/Autonomous and Connected Vehicles (GRVA) guidance on screening UN Regulations (GRVA-14-54/Rev.1), GRE agreed to revert to this issue at the next session. | ||||||||
